Daughter A Stewart 1407–1496 – Genealogical Records

Birth Date: Apr 1407

Birth Location: Lorn, Scotland

Death Date: Feb 1496

Death Location: Haddington, East Lothian, Scotland

Father: Robert Stewart

Mother: Joan Stewart

Spouse(s): John Lindsay

Children(s): Christian Lindsay

In 1407, Daughter A Stewart entered the world in Lorn, Scotland, born to Robert Stewart And Joan Lady Lorn Stewart. Daughter A Stewart married John Lindsay, and had children including Christian Lindsay. Daughter A Stewart passed away in 1496 in Haddington, East Lothian, Scotland.
